Is God really our everything, or is God the 'most of things' to us? As long as there's something we still hold on to, something we claim as ours, then God is no longer our Lord of 'all' in this sense. He has becomes the Lord of 'most'.
It's like buying a zinger meal without drink, or having the full meal but no straw.
A Lord is someone who oversees all, makes decision over everything and is sovereign. Thus what Pastor said make sense, if He is not our Lord of all, the word Lord becomes broken, and such, He is not our Lord at all. The sinner's prayer is the first and most fundamental prayer we make.
Together, let's make the deepest foundation strong or else we should crumble.
